Das Kopftuch

German, Akif Hilâl Öztürk, 2006

Should civil servants in Germany be allowed to wear headscarves? The state's open neutrality actually supports this. However, some federal states have enacted laws aimed at preventing female civil servants from wearing headscarves due to the Ludin decision. It becomes evident that these laws conflict with constitutional and European law. Subsequently, a proposal for a constitutionally and EU-compliant law will be presented. Additionally, an insight into the Turkish legal situation will be provided. A comparison with Turkey, the country of origin for most headscarf wearers in Germany, shows that Turkey has a different approach to the headscarf. A strictly secular path, in the Turkish sense, is pursued. There is a complete ban on headscarves in public sector jobs. Another focus of the work is the question of whether female employees are allowed to wear headscarves in the workplace.
